President Donald Trump shared with reporters inside the Oval Office on Tuesday that he intends to use “heavy force” against anyone protesting his June 14 parade celebrating the Army‘s 250th anniversary.
“If there’s any protester that wants to come out, they will be met with very big force,” Trump said. “I haven’t even heard about a protest, but you know, these are people who hate our country, but they will be met with very heavy force.”
